Transaction bff4f1bdbedd44a3e355d6f1008dabcca789abafdac9cb15e46adc30b95a6660

block
f4d43718c7a8dded0922cf85d4cbec842abcf3972e093f97341fe3f032f2dc18

1 Input

23 Outputs